"I grew up on a farm in Marysville, California and I can remember seeing the SR-71 Blackbird fly through the sky like a black dagger.  My parents were friends with some officers and NCOs from Beale AFB and I was inspired by their sharp looks and well-spoken attitudes. When the draft came around in 1969 it was like a nudge for me to join. Although I initially only wanted to serve for four years, 33 years went by and it was the best decision I made. I saw some amazing things from the repatriation of Vietnam POWs like Senator John McCain and Jeremiah Denton to the fall of the Berlin wall which I didn't just read about but got to witness first-hand."

Harl Sanderson, 9th Mission Support Group, deputy director for installation support
Hometown: Marysville, California
